1 Cinnabon Locations in Eden, ID

  • Traveler's Oasis - Eden

    9:00 AM - 9:00 PM 9:00 AM - 9:00 PM 9:00 AM - 9:00 PM 9:00 AM - 9:00 PM 9:00 AM - 9:00 PM 9:00 AM - 9:00 PM 9:00 AM - 9:00 PM
    phone
    1017 S. 1150 E
    Eden, ID 83325
    US